Abstract

The airbag assembly features an inflatable cushion having a split pocket at its lower portion and may also include a recess in its lower portion. The split pocket and recess allows the cushion to receive a rear-facing child car seat during deployment. The airbag assembly may further include a tethering system to control deployment of the pocket and the split sections of the cushion.
